The SAKURA Pigma Micron Pens come in a convenient 6-pack with assorted point sizes ranging from 005 (0.20mm) to 08 (0.50mm). This variety allows me to switch between fine detailing and broader strokes effortlessly. For instance, I love using the 005 for intricate sketches and the 05 for bolder outlines. Understanding Tip Sizes
One of the first things I learned about Micron pens is the variety of tip sizes available. The tip sizes typically range from 0.2 mm to 0.8 mm. I found that smaller tips are ideal for detailed work, while larger tips provide bolder lines. Depending on my project, I choose the tip size that best suits my needs.
Ink Quality and Type
The ink quality in Micron fine tip pens is another aspect I appreciate. They use archival ink that is fade-resistant and water-resistant. This means my drawings and notes remain vibrant over time. I also enjoy the fact that the ink flows smoothly, providing a consistent writing experience.
Paper Compatibility
Before I started using Micron pens, I quickly realized the importance of paper compatibility. These pens work well on a variety of surfaces, but I prefer using them on smooth paper. I noticed that rougher surfaces can cause the ink to skip or bleed, so I always choose my paper carefully.
